Ready2Swim- It took my city 6 weeks to get the permit. Deposit on May 9th - they started the dig about 3 business days after they got the permit. I think they dug June 21st. Do you have a permit yet?

Everything has been really right in a row - except we had the first inspection delayed (the city again), and then a lot of rain right before the shotcrete, with a cave-in that had to be repaired.

This week has been the first one where we haven't had any movement - but then again it is good to have the concrete cure for about a month before they install the finish - so I am not complaining.

So according to the "schedule" we are about a week behind - not too bad - I expected about 16 weeks from contract to swim (which would be the beginning of Septmeber) - and now I think they may be done in the middle of August - so closer to 14 weeks.
